Unveiling the Clockwork Universe

The concept of a ordered universe, often dubbed the "Clockwork Universe," presents a compelling view of reality. Picture a enormous system of components, accurately fitted and functioning together, determined by unwavering laws of mechanics. This idea initially attracted traction during the Age of Reason , fueled by discoveries in astronomy and the emergence of sophisticated measurement devices. Detractors argue that it excludes space for randomness, while advocates find elegance in its consistency. Essentially, the notion continues to fuel discussion regarding the essence of existence and our role within it.

Overhauling Antique Spring-driven Movements

Returning antique spring-driven mechanisms back to functionality is a intricate craft . Typically, these complex assemblies suffer from centuries of inactivity , resulting in stiff gears, corroded parts, and a absence of greasing. A experienced horologist meticulously disassembles each piece , polishes them thoroughly , exchanges damaged components with suitable replacements, and then lubricates the whole assembly to ensure reliable timekeeping. This process requires dedication and a comprehensive grasp of clockwork principles .

Mechanical Art and Its Current Echoes

The intriguing world of clockwork art, dating back to the 18th and 19th centuries, demonstrated a remarkable combination of engineering and artistic craftsmanship. These elaborate creations, often displaying mechanical figures , captivated audiences with their precise movements. Now, a revived appreciation for this traditional form is appearing in contemporary art. Designers are reinterpreting the principles of mechanical engineering, incorporating robotics, kinetic elements, and programming to produce works that mirror the ingenuity of their predecessors while pushing the boundaries of what art can achieve . This current dialogue between past and present highlights the enduring appeal of mechanical artistry.
